10 Organization of fuel distribution: a determining factor to define the market opportunity FUEL DISTRIBUTION MARKET CONCENTRATION MAIN TYPES OF F&F SOLUTIONS Consolidated Fragmented Independent / franchise Accessible for F&F management players Multibrand (1) domestic solutions OWNERSHIP OF FUEL STATIONS Oil company subsidiaries Not accessible for F&F management players Difficult for F&F management players Monobrand (2) solutions Multibrand transnational solutions The opportunities for F&F management players depend on the fuel distribution market s structure (1) Multibrand: card accepted in a network of affiliated stations. (2) Monobrand: card accepted in a specific brand network. 10

11 Trend in the fuel distribution market by region North America & UK Historically fragmented distribution market with ~30 major oil companies, which moved to franchise in the 80s Europe (excl. UK) Domestic fuel distribution mostly owned by oil companies Few specialized players moving from monobrand cards to multibrand cards, enriched with services Main programs directly managed by oil companies or some specialized players for transnational freight (solutions to pay fuel & tolls in many countries) Latin America Mostly franchised and fragmented distribution market Asia Fuel distribution mostly owned by oil companies or potentially state-owned distributors Specialized players offering multibrand solutions to pay for fuel in a large acceptance network composed of affiliated stations Main programs directly managed by the distributors / oil companies Market opportunities and offers vary by region, xx depending on the organization of local fuel distribution 11

29 Mexican F&F market: potential and addressable markets Total potential market: annual fuel consumption in the BtoB sector Independent segment $24bn Business segment Not yet addressable: Small companies or independent drivers mostly operating in informal economy $16bn 4.5m vehicles $8bn 1m vehicles Addressable market: Companies looking for cost reductions and tax deduction (1) A large addressable market of $8bn (1) 2005 law: fuel expenses deductible only if paid electronically. 29

30 Mexican F&F market: structure and segments Independent / franchise OWNERSHIP Consolidated MEX CONCENTRATION Fragmented Mexican market specificities All stations operating under Pemex brand but as franchisees A market with multibrand domestic solutions (1) Oil company subsidiaries Two segments: Light Fleets Size $3.8 bn Heavy Fleets Size $4.4 bn Penetration (2) 44% Penetration (2) 6% A consolidated market with franchisees, favorable for multibrand expense management solutions (1) Multibrand: card accepted in a network of affiliated stations. (2) Penetration of multibrand cards. 30

47 Repom: a strong experience in the market 1993 Company created 1999 Freight payment launched 2004 Toll payment card launched 2012 New regulations Repom first to get the license 1995 Fuel cards for heavy fleets launched 2001 Fuel card product withdrawn 2011 MasterCard issuer license 2013 Acquisition of 62% stake by Edenred Repom, a pioneer in the market that started to operate long before the 2012 regulation 47

50 Repom: business model Issue volume (IV) Fuel (closed loop) Client fee ~0.7% on BV Volume w/o affiliate fee (cash withdrawal/ wired transfers) ~68% Business Volume (BV) ~25% ~6% ~1% Toll MasterCard network Affiliate fee ~ % on BV ~1.9% on IV Average take-up rate: 1.2%-1.4% on BV Great opportunity to increase the take-up rate, by transferring wired transfers volumes to the MasterCard network 50

51 Opportunities in the market Regulatory change A priority for the government to reduce the informal economy and increase tax collection Implementation in progress An acceleration factor for our business to grow faster Services for truck-drivers Main sales focus on corporate clients until recently Since 2012, focus extended to independent truckdrivers through Clube da Estrada brand (loyalty program, additional card for their wives, service points on the roads, etc.) facebook.com/clubedaestr ada Synergies with Edenred Cross-selling opportunities Leverage Edenred partnership Leverage network relationships Expected business volume CAGR by 2016: >30% 51
